This is a hand sanitizer with instructions to apply enough product in palm and rub hand together for 20 seconds until dry. It contains water, glycerin, C70-100 carbomer and sodium hydroxide. Children under 6 years of age should be supervised when using it. It should be kept away from a source of heat, fire or flame and avoid contact with eyes. If irritation or redness develops and lasts, contact a doctor. It may discolor certain fabrics and surfaces. In case of ingestion, get medical help or contact Poison Control Center immediately. The product should be stored below 105°F (40°C). For questions or comments, the number to call is 1-800-535-4980.*
